Supposedly my sinus infection is gone. Thanks, that's the least the antibiotic could do after causing a biphasic allergic reaction and having me admitted to the hospital overnight, that insurance has decided not to cover. sorry for run-on sentence.....
I am still sick but should not be having sinus problems. Can someone please tell my sinuses??!! The pain is unbelieveable but no congestion. I decided to try the neti pot since I already use saline mist. Dr. said it will go further into sinuses than the spray. I researched it here and saw some positive info. I just tried it and if nothing else it gave me some slight relief. I plan to use it every day even if I only get a few minutes of relief. It was a lot easier than I thought it would be, was not uncomfortable or gross at all. I'll let you know how it goes after a few days.
